What Is a Crimp Tool?

A crimp tool is a hand-operated or powered device used to compress a metal connector around a wire or terminal. The tool deforms one or both components to form a cold weld, ensuring electrical continuity and mechanical strength.

How Crimp Tools Work

The basic mechanism involves inserting a stripped wire into a connector and then squeezing the crimping tool to compress the connector tightly around the wire. This forms a secure, conductive bond that resists vibration, pulling, and corrosion.

Types of Crimp Tools

Crimp tools come in various designs, each tailored for specific tasks. Choosing the right one depends on the type of work, wire gauge, and connector type.

Handheld Crimp Tools

These are the most common and economical types, ideal for small-scale projects or hobby work. They're lightweight, portable, and suitable for light-duty crimping.

Ratchet Crimp Tools

Designed for consistent performance, ratchet crimp tools feature a mechanism that ensures the crimp cycle is fully completed before releasing the tool. This prevents weak or partial crimps.

Hydraulic Crimp Tools

These heavy-duty tools use hydraulic pressure to crimp large-gauge wires or cables. They're typically used in industrial or automotive applications.

Pneumatic Crimp Tools

Powered by compressed air, pneumatic crimpers are ideal for high-volume operations. They reduce hand fatigue and improve precision.

Automatic Crimping Machines

Used in manufacturing, these machines perform thousands of crimps per hour. They ensure consistency, speed, and precision with minimal human intervention.

Best Practices for Crimping

Following proper procedures ensures strong, safe, and reliable connections.

Steps to Perform a Perfect Crimp

  1. Strip the wire to the correct length.

  2. Insert the wire into the connector.

  3. Position in the crimp tool’s die.

  4. Squeeze the handles until the ratchet releases.

  5. Tug gently to test the connection.

Common Crimping Mistakes to Avoid

  • Using the wrong tool or die.

  • Incomplete or over-crimping.

  • Not stripping the wire correctly.

  • Crimping insulated connectors with non-insulated dies.

Frequently Asked Questions (FAQS)

Q1: Can I use a crimp tool for all types of wire?
No, always match the tool and die to the wire gauge and connector type.

Q2: Is crimping better than soldering?
For many applications, yes. It’s faster, easier, and creates a stronger mechanical bond.

Q3: How long do crimp tools last?
With proper care, high-quality crimp tools can last for years, even in professional settings.

Q4: Do I need different tools for insulated and non-insulated terminals?
Yes, using the correct tool ensures proper deformation of the connector.

Q5: Can I reuse crimp connectors?
Generally, no. Crimp connectors are designed for one-time use to ensure integrity.
